American Express presents BST Hyde Park’s opening night of 2023 will host the launch of a very special new classical music live experience All Things Orchestral on Friday 23 June, presented by Myleene Klass, featuring Alfie Boe and performed by the world-famous Royal Philharmonic Concert Orchestra and conducted by Michael England.

Using BST Hyde Park’s famous Great Oak Stage, which has hosted the world’s biggest music legends since 2013, fans will be taken on a summer night’s journey through classical music, both traditional and modern.

With music education declining in schools, orchestra and arts organisations’ funding cut, BBC orchestras and the BBC Singers facing cuts or elimination and attendance of classical performances in decline, All Things Orchestral is here to turn the tables and bring classical music back for all - with affordable ticket prices and the world-class live experience that has made BST Hyde Park a favourite fixture in London’s summer event calendar. One of the world’s biggest music festivals will be celebrating classical music and launching All Things Orchestral as an event that can tour the UK.

True to the accessible ethos of All Things Orchestral, general admission ticket prices will be available from £11.45 (inclusive of fees).

Superstar tenor Alfie Boe OBE is our star guest performer. Alfie Boe OBE is one of the most successful classical singers of his generation. The much-loved tenor may have performed in some of the world's great classical venues, but he also has the rare ability to bring together all sorts of music lovers. Not many artists can lay claim to having appeared in Les Miserables, La Boheme and a spectacular orchestral version of the classic rock album Quadrophenia.

Ever since he exploded onto the music scene nearly 20 years ago, Alfie has racked up one extraordinary achievement after another, building a loyal audience on both sides of the Atlantic. He has three UK Number 1 albums to his credit, while his collaborations with another versatile singer, his good friend Michael Ball, have together sold more than one million copies. Plus he has the royal seal of approval, having been awarded an OBE for services to music and charity in the Queen's Birthday Honours List.

Lucy Noble, Artistic Director at AEG Presents, says, “We are thrilled to be presenting this amazing Classical concert as part of BST Hyde Park. Classical and orchestral music is for everyone and can be a lot of fun. Somewhere along the way, however, classical music concerts have become a hushed and staid experience.  When the repertoire was written, audiences would spontaneously cheer and clap and enjoy it just like any other live music today. By bringing All Things Orchestral to BST Hyde Park, we will unlock that passion, accessibility and hopefully a love of classical performance for a new generation. And once again show everyone that it is music to be enjoyed just like any other.”
